Testis cancer is the most common solid tumor malignancy of young men. Select patients with early stage cancer may be spared long incisions for lymph node dissection by laparoscopic surgery.
Using the minimally invasive techniques, patients are able to leave the hospital in one to two days, with an overall recovery period of two to three weeks. In contrast, those receiving standard lymph node dissection spend three to four days in the hospital, with recovery lasting six to eight weeks.
